Common outputs of monitoring and controlling across all knowledge areas include performance reports, which provide insights into project progress and performance metrics. Additionally, change requests may arise to address variances from the project plan, necessitating adjustments. Other outputs can include updated project management plans and lessons learned documentation, which inform future projects and improve overall project management practices.

What are common project management problems and how can they be effectively resolved?

Common project management problems include scope creep, lack of communication, resource constraints, and unrealistic deadlines. These issues can be effectively resolved by clearly defining project scope, establishing open lines of communication, allocating resources efficiently, and setting realistic timelines with buffer time for unexpected delays. Regular monitoring and adjustment of the project plan can also help in addressing and preventing potential problems.

What are The common organizational controls?

Common organizational controls include policies and procedures that govern operations, risk management frameworks, and compliance measures to ensure adherence to laws and regulations. Other key controls involve internal audits, financial controls, and performance monitoring systems that help assess efficiency and effectiveness. Additionally, access controls and information security measures protect sensitive data and resources. Together, these controls help organizations achieve their objectives while minimizing risks and ensuring accountability.

What common functions do all managers perform?

Common functions that all managers perform include planning, organizing, leading, and controlling. Planning involves setting goals and deciding on the best course of action to achieve them. Organizing involves arranging resources and tasks to achieve the goals. Leading involves influencing and motivating employees to work towards the goals. Controlling involves monitoring progress and ensuring that the goals are being met.

Why were secrets of silk-making so closely guarded?

Silk was - and still is - a very expensive material; controlling knowledge the process by which silk cloth is made allows you to be the only producer of silk and name your own price. Once it becomes common knowledge, anyone can make it and under-cut your price.
